Otumfuo decries abandonment of hospital projects, calls for urgent completion

July 27, 2026
27519-2

The Asantehene, Otumfuo Osei Tutu II, has expressed deep concern over the habitual abandonment of hospital projects by successive governments, warning that the trend continues to fuel severe congestion and the persistent “no-bed syndrome” across the country’s major health facilities.

Speaking during a courtesy visit by the Minister of Health and a delegation from the Ghana Medical Trust Fund at the Manhyia Palace, the Asantehene stressed that uncompleted health infrastructure leaves existing hospitals dangerously overstretched and unable to cope with patient demand.

He urged the government to prioritise finishing these abandoned projects to ease pressure on health workers and significantly improve healthcare delivery nationwide.

The visit by the Health Minister, accompanied by the Ashanti Regional Minister, Frank Amoakohene, and key sector leaders, was aimed at briefing His Majesty on critical progress and ongoing reforms within Ghana’s health sector.

The delegation included the Administrator of the Ghana Medical Trust Fund, Obuobia Darko-Opoku, the Director-General of the Ghana Health Service, the heads of the National Ambulance Service and the Traditional Medicine Practice Council, Yakubu Tobor Yusuf, alongside top directors from the Ministry of Health.

Briefing the Asantehene, the Minister highlighted key government interventions, including President John Dramani Mahama’s Free Primary Healthcare policy and the Ghana Medical Trust Fund, popularly known as “Mahamacares.”

He assured His Majesty that active steps are being taken to address the inherited backlog of over 100,000 unrecruited health workers, ensure the equitable distribution of staff across the regions, and accelerate the completion of crucial infrastructure projects, including the Trede, Oforikrom, and Sewua hospitals.
